Deputy City Manager, City of Long Beach
Teresa Chandler is a Deputy City Manager for the City of Long Beach with the responsibility of elevating the City’s coordinated efforts related to homelessness, violence prevention, and youth development. She also provides oversight and leadership to the City’s Office of Civic Innovations and the Office of Equity. She most recently supported the team through a racial equity and reconciliation planning process to develop a City-wide plan to eliminate systemic racism by advancing racial equity in Long Beach. The City codified this work in its Framework for Racial Equity & Reconciliation, which lays out 21 strategies and 107 potential plans for action with four goals: 1) Ending systemic racism in all local government and partner agencies of Long Beach, 2) Designing and investing in community safety and violence prevention, 3) Redesigning the Long Beach Police Department’s approach to community safety, and 4) Improving health and wellness in the City by eliminating social and economic disparities in the communities most impacted by racism.
